County of Tuolumne v. Oakdale Irrigation District
196 F.2d 927, 196 P.2d 927, 32 Cal. 2d 891, 1948 Cal. LEXIS 274
Opinion
This case involves the same questions presented in County of Mariposa v. Merced Irrigation District, ante, p. 467 [196 P.2d 920], and is controlled thereby. Therefore the petition for a peremptory writ of mandate is denied, and the alternative writ is discharged.
Gibson, C. J., Shenk, J., Edmonds, J., Traynor, J., Schauer, J., and Spence, J., concurred.
Petitioner’s application for a rehearing was denied September 27,1948.
